This long-awaited origin story of how the most iconic characters in the “Transformers” universe, Orion Pax and D-16, went from brothers-in-arms to become sworn enemies, Optimus Prime and Megatron, debuted its trailer on Thursday, April 18th. The launch kicked off at 6am Pt with a live-streamed countdown showing the journey into space. After one hour, the craft reached its peak at 125,000 feet above the Earth, revealing the trailer with a custom introduction video from our stars: Chris Hemsworth and Brian Tyree Henry. The event was streamed from @TransformersMovie social accounts, The Paramount Pictures YouTube channel and co-streamed by Chris Hemsworth on Instagram.
Synopsis: Transformers One is the untold origin story of Optimus Prime and Megatron, better known as sworn enemies, but once were friends bonded like brothers who changed the fate of Cybertron forever.

Paramount has delayed “Aang: The Last Airbender” to 2026 and moved “Transformers One” back by one week.
The animated “Avatar: The Last Airbender” spinoff was previously set for Oct. 10, 2025, and will now open on Jan. 20, 2026. Dave Bautista and Eric Nam are headlining the voice cast for the film, which is in development at Paramount and Nickelodeon Studios. Plot details haven’t been revealed, but Bautista will voice a villain character.
Lauren Montgomery, who worked on the original “Avatar: The Last Airbender” television show, is directing the project with William Mata. Series creators Michael Dimartino and Bryan Konietzko are serving as executive producers alongside Eric Coleman.
Elsewhere on Paramount’s release calendar, “Transformers One” will debut on Sept. 20, 2024, instead of Sept. 13. On its new date, the animated “Transformers” adventure will play in Imax and open in theaters on the same day as Universal and DreamWorks Animation’s “The Wild Robot.”

Transformers One, is going now on Sept. 20 instead of Sept. 13.
The move gets Transformers One further away from Beetlejuice Beetlejuice which is going to eat up the September box office. However, already on this weekend is DreamWorks Animation/Universal’s Wild Robot. Two big animated movies are certainly not going to live on the same weekend.
The release date change also comes in the wake of the great reception that Transformers One received out of CinemaCon last week. Late September has been a rich bed for family animated movies including Hotel Transylvania 2 ($48.2M opening), Hotel Transylvania ($42.5M opening) and Cloudy With a Chance of Meatballs ($34M opening).
Transformers One is among one of Paramount’s highest tested movies in the studio’s history.

Autobots, assemble: Paramount has released a trailer for “Transformers One,” the animated prequel film led by the voices of Chris Hemsworth, Brian Tyree Henry and Scarlett Johansson.
Hemsworth voices young Optimus Prime, when he was just known as Orion Pax. Henry is D-16, before he became Optimus’ rival Megatron. The trailer shows the two starting out as simple worker bots, unable to transform into anything. But soon they gain the ability to change into vehicles and gain weapons, as a battle against a mysterious, plant-like villain unfolds on the Transformers’ home planet of Cybertron.
Other cast members include Johansson as Elita, Keegan-Michael Key as Bumblebee, Jon Hamm as Sentinel Prime and Laurence Fishburne as Alpha Trion. Hemsworth and Henry introduced a first look at the prequel film April 11 at CinemaCon.
The franchise first hit the big screen with an animated movie in 1986 before director Michael Bay launched a live-action series...

Paramount is delaying the release of the next animated feature in the Transformers Universe, Transformers One. Initially set for release on July 19, 2024, the film will open nationwide on September 12, 2024. Josh Cooley directs from a script by Andrew Barrer, Steve Desmond, and Gabriel Ferrari. Focusing on an origin story set on Cybertron, Transformers One revolves around the relationship and rivalry of Autobot Optimus Prime (Chris Hemsworth) and the Decepticon Megatron (Brian Tyree Henry). Other stars joining the cast include Scarlett Johansson as Elita, Keegan-Michael Key as Bumblebee, Jon Hamm as Sentinel Prime, and Laurence Fishburne as Alpha Trion.
Regarding the upcoming film, franchise producer Lorenzo di Bonaventura shared details about the epic animated prequel, saying, “I could tell you really important parts of this story, which is more than a tease. Paramount has pushed back the release date for Transformers One, the newest animated feature in the Transformers franchise that was unveiled at CinemaCon in April. The origin story from director Josh Cooley, previously set to open on July 19, 2024, will now bow nationwide on September 13, 2024.
While the sole competitor on its new date is an untitled film from Uni/Blumhouse, the project hits theaters shortly after the September 6th debut of Warner Bros’ Beetlejuice 2, Disney’s Blade and another unknown Disney pic. It had previously been set to contend with Universal’s Twisters.
Hailing from Paramount Animation, Hasbro and eOne, Transformers One tells the story of how a young Optimus Prime (Chris Hemsworth) and Megatron (Brian Tyree Henry) went from being brothers-in-arms to sworn enemies. Also starring are Scarlett Johansson, Keegan-Michael Key, Jon Hamm and Laurence Fishburne, who are respectively voicing Elita, Bumblebee, Sentinel Prime and Alpha Trion.

The Robots in Disguise return to theaters with a new mission the weekend of June 9, and analysts are already crunching numbers for the film’s summertime debut. According to Hollywood trend watchers and number hounds, Transformers: Rise of the Beasts could make $68M to $70M in its opening weekend in the U.S. and Canada.
That number is impressive after 2018’s Bumblebee opened to $21.6M in the domestic market, while Transformers: The Last Knight did $44.6M over a $68.4M Wednesday through Sunday window. If Transformers: Rise of the Beasts performs as expected, the action-packed installment inspired by a nostalgic property will be another win for the recovering box office. For those keeping track, Fast X is racing toward a $60M debut, with Disney’s live-action version of The Little Mermaid swimming toward $110M. Elsewhere, Spider-Man: Acorss the Spider-Verse could web up $80M, setting the summer box office on fire.
